Function 2......Sets the sensitivity adjustment method to [Multi] and changes the sensitivity level
of the sensor, turns off the laser, or changes gradations.
SENSM <Priority item> <Sensitivity levelLower limit> <Sensitivity levelUpper limit>
Input
<Gradations>
• Specify the item that has priority at the time of multiple sensitivity adjustment as the
priority item.
Priority item
0
1
• Specify values in the range from 0 to 31 (0 to 25 if the sampling period has priority)
for the sensitivity level lower limit and sensitivity level upper limit.
The optimum sensitivity level is set within the range from the lower limit to upper
limit.Set the values so that the lower limit is equal to or less than the upper limit.
If the same value is set for the lower limit and upper limit, the sensitivity will be fixed
at that level.
If both the lower limit and upper limit are set to 0, the laser will be turned off.
(However, a measurement error will be generated.)
• Specify a value in the range between 120 and 220 for gradations as the target value
of sensor sensitivity adjustment.
(Specify 170 under normal circumstances.)
The total delay time for turning the laser off can be shortened more with input from the terminal
block. If the laser must be turned off instantaneously, use the LD-OFF input terminal.
